On quantization of black holes. (English) Zbl 0956.83531

Summary: A black hole model with a self-gravitating charged spherically symmetric thin dust shell as a source is considered. A Schrödinger-type equation for such a model is derived. This equation appears to be a difference equation. A theory of such an equation is developed and its general solution is found and studied in detail. A discrete spectrum of bound state energy levels is obtained. All the eigenvalues appear to be infinitely degenerate. The ground state wave functions are evaluated explicitly. Quantum black hole states are selected and investigated. It is shown that the obtained black hole mass spectrum is compatible with the existence of Hawking’s radiation in the limit of low temperatures both for large and for nearly extreme Reissner-Nordstróm black holes. The above-mentioned infinite degeneracy of the mass (energy) eigenvalues may be helpful in resolving the well-known information paradox in black hole physics.
